WIND OF SPRING  by Elizabeth Yates “Wind of Spring” is a quiet simply told story of Susie Minton. The style in which it is written does not at all conform to the modern trend, and this I found rather refreshing. There is nothing to grip the imagination, yet the reader’s attention is held throughout the book. Susie, at the age of twelve started out her life work as a maid “in service”.
